Student Recruitment & Services Representative (Bilingual)

Contact North | Contact Nord is seeking a positive, energetic, and organized individual to fill the following part-time position:

STUDENT RECRUITMENT & SERVICES REPRESENTATIVE – Windsor (Bilingual)

Reporting to the Education & Training Advisor, the Student Recruitment & Services Representative position is based out of our Windsor online learning centre. The successful candidate will:

Job Description

  • Actively support the Education & Training Advisor to recruit students by responding to e-mail and telephone inquiries at the online learning centre, booking appointments for the Education & Training Advisor and supporting the Education & Training Advisor in other recruitment activities as needed.
  • Directly recruit students in the community following the standard recruitment process and build local community partnerships to act as referral sources as requested by the Education & Training Advisor and within parameters set by the Education & Training Advisor.
  • Prepare and maintain the online learning centre to support students using the centre.
  • Provide technical support to students using the learning technologies and computer workstations at the online learning centre and accessing the web conferencing platform from home.
  • Enter and update complete and accurate data in the customer relationship management (CRM) tool ensuring all required fields are populated on a daily and ongoing basis and record data on Requests for Services responded to at the online learning centre each Friday afternoon.
  • Coordinate logistics and supervise examinations at the online learning centre in accordance with the Examination Policy and Procedures.
  • Provide support and technical services to students studying from home.

Qualifications

  • A Secondary School Diploma with preference given to those with a post-secondary credential in a related field such as office administration, business administration, executive assistant.
  • 1-3 years customer service experience in fields such as retail, call centre, banks/insurance companies.
  • 1-3 years experience in a sales position, such as retail, call centre, business sales, banks/insurance companies.
  • Proven bilingualism (written and oral) in areas designated under the French Language Services Act; proven bilingualism is an asset in areas not designated under the Act
  • Experience with, or a willingness, to learn to use a variety of learning technologies such as audio, video and web conferencing.
  • Able to take full responsibility for key assigned areas of student services process while working with minimal supervision.
  • Highly developed verbal and written communication skills.
  • Previous data entry experience.
  • Experience with or knowledge of online learning.
  • Sound functional knowledge of MS Office Suite (Word, PowerPoint, Excel and Outlook).
  • Proven ability to exercise sound judgement and diplomacy through contact with students, faculty/instructors, local host and other community stakeholders.
  • Must be fully bilingual (English/French)

WHO ARE WE?

As Ontario's community-based bilingual distance education and training network, Contact North | Contact Nord helps underserved residents in 1,300 small, rural, remote, Indigenous and Francophone communities access education and training without leaving their communities.
